 +    * new function to convert [[http://wagerlab.colorado.edu/tools|Tor Wager's cluster structures]] to [[xff - VMP format|VMP objects]], [[ac2vmp]]
 +    * new function (and datafile) to convert ICBM (segmentation-based) coordinates to TAL and back, [[icbm2tal]] and [[tal2icbm]]
 +    * new function to compute p/se/t-test statistics on (single-level) mediation path analysis model, [[mediationpset]]
 +    * new function to regress per-voxel unique models for mass-univariate cases, [[mmregress]]
 +    * new function to split a series of [[xff - PRT format|PRT files]] to single-trial PRTs, [[singletrialprts]]
 +    * new function to create icosahedron meshes, [[spheresrf]]
 +    * new MEX function to apply SPM normalization to coordinates (and ranges), [[applyspmsnc]]
 +    * new MEX function to build a vertex-based border reconstruction on a segmented voxel object, [[mesh_reconstruct]]

 +  * substantially enhanced features
 +    * the orientation is now coded as a transformation matrix internally, so that it is fully supported for all datatypes and operations
 +    * painting now also works for HDR objects with any transformation matrix
 +    * the main menu is extended in minimized mode (adding a statistics and VOI menu to access those elements that become invisible via a menu tree)
 +    * the contrast manager now allows to extract VOI-based condition/contrast values per subject as covariates
 +    * the GLM beta plotter now also supports quadratic fit to scattered data, robust regression, legends, multi-group scattering, value scatters on bar graph overlay, subject labels on scattered values, trend lines, and confidence ellipses (for linear regressions)
 +    * the libSVM contribution has been updated to v3.1 (April 2011)
 +    * auxiliary information on objects is now stored in files with the ''.rtv'' extension instead of the ''.mat'' extension; this avoids problems when user-defined files with the same name but the ''.mat'' extension exist, and also allows information on actual ''.mat'' files to be stored
 +    * the GLM computation method ([[mdm.ComputeGLM|MDM::ComputeGLM]]) now supports adding subjects to an existing GLM file
 +    * the cluster-table method, [[vmp.ClusterTable|AFT::ClusterTable]], is now available for other object types (CMP, HDR, HEAD) as well
 +    * the NeuroElf GUI function was split into sub-functions to improve coding and debugging
 +    * support for compound datatypes for [[xff - HDR format|HDR/NII files]] (RGB and RGBA content), e.g. such as used by the [[https://www.loni.ucla.edu/Atlases/Atlas_Detail.jsp?atlas_id=15|ICBM DTI Color Atlas]] available at LONI)
 +  * major bug fixes
 +    * colors and alpha settings are now correctly copied from displayed surface objects when undocking the window (e.g. for flat maps with statistics)
 +    * when deleting one of only two defined groups, now the contrast manager deletes the group definition entirely (after a request, before it would simply disable grouping, effectively disallowing to remove the definition)
 +    * the [[aft.ReloadFromDisk|AFT::ReloadFromDisk]] method now also works for files/objects for which the filetype needs to be known (an additional parameter is passed to the call to [[xff]] when re-loading the object)
 +    * the [[glm.RemoveSubject|GLM::RemoveSubject]] method now updates all ''.RunTimeVars'' subfields appropriately
 +    * the [[glm.SingleStudy_tMap|GLM::SingleStudy_tMap]] method now computes the correct ''.DF1'' map parameter (before only the number of timepoints of the first study were used; this now allows to use this method to compute FFX contrasts)
 +    * the [[prt.Concatenate|PRT::Concatenate]] method now uses the given TR correctly
 +    * the [[vtc.VOITimeCourse|VTC::VOITimeCourse]] method now allows to use anatomical ROIs when using transio (before this combination likely led to an error message, given that transio access does not allow to re-use the same index more than once)
 +    * when using surface meshes with [[alphasim]], the sampling now follows the configuration along the normal vector (before the sampling would always occur at ''vertex + 1 * normal'')
 +    * [[spm5_preprojobs]] now correctly either removes (4D Nifti) or skips (3D Analyze volumes) the desired number of discarded acquisitions, regardless of any pre-existing data files
 +    * error bands are now always plotted into the correct axes when using [[tcplot]] (before, plotting into a non-current axes would plot the error bands into the currect axes object instead)
 +    * the xff private function [[dcmio]] now correctly reads files even if some value representation (VR) tags are incorrect
 +    * using the [[normcdfc]] MEX function now cannot lead to a SEGV segmentation fault (before, one value too many was processed)
 +    * psctrans and ztrans now correctly reject NaN/Inf values, and time-courses without variation are returned as all 0's (for ztrans)
 +    * when using robust regression in a N-group comparison with more than 2 groups, now all group comparisons are returned (before only the last group comparison was returned)
